Secret art, manoeuvring public vehicle across the pond (9)
![Ross](/clue/static/ross-mug.min.png)
I believe the answer is:
streetcar
'public vehicle across the pond' is the definition.
I can't tell whether this definition defines the answer.
'secret art manoeuvring' is the wordplay.
'manoeuvring' is an anagram indicator.
'secret'+'art'='secretart'
'secretart' anagrammed gives 'STREETCAR'.
